Right-click the Windows Start menu and open Device Manager . Look for yellow warning flags under Ports (COM & LPT) or Universal Serial Bus controllers . Right-click the ZTE entries, select Uninstall Device , unplug the modem, restart your PC, and plug it back in to force a driver reinstall. 3.
